The Department of Systemic Cell Biology (Prof. Dr. Bastiaens) at the Max Planck Institute for Molecular Physiology is offering a postdoctoral position to work in an interdisciplinary team of biochemists and physicists towards reconstituting life-like systems from biochemical building blocks.
Requirements:
- Applications are open to enthusiastic, inquisitive and creative individual with a degree in Life Sciences and a PhD in Biochemistry.
- Applicant should have extensive experience with protein biochemistry, purification and enzymology and has a keen interest in understanding biochemical reaction dynamics.
- Applicant must have experience in lipid biochemistry and has basic knowledge about microscopic imaging technologies.
Duration: limited to 2 years
Starting date: available immediately
